Financial Resource Advocate
Renown Health is a healthcare organization seeking a Financial Resource Advocate to serve as the primary contact for patient reimbursement issues. The role involves providing information on treatment costs, verifying insurance eligibility, and acting as a liaison between patients and various agencies to ensure access to financial assistance.

Responsibilities
Serve as the patient’s primary contact for patient reimbursement issues in accordance with established policies
Provide information regarding treatment costs, out-of-pocket patient responsibility, hospital payment requirements, alternative financing and charity care programs
Determine the eligibility of patients for specific programs
Act as liaison between the patient, family, county, and governmental agencies
Expedite and provide access to the hospital through the gathering of demographic, clinical, financial, and statistical information from patients and their families
Ensure that the company will be reimbursed for services by verifying and documenting insurance eligibility, and benefit coverage using all available technology
Collect payments, initiate financial assistance and educate the public on the billing policies and procedures of the company and avenues of financial assistance
Keep abreast of all changes involving governmental and community agencies, insurance coverage, grants specific to the patient and other options/resources available
Professionally and diplomatically work with and communicate positively with patients of all ages, their families and physicians regarding financial matters and ensure system documentation reflects the correct billing information
Provide information to the patients about the appropriate government agencies or other resources that may provide the financially restricted patients with assistance based on the patient’s qualifications
Work cooperatively and professionally with hospital staff, community/outside agencies, and physician offices
Make independent decisions except in matters involving non-routine problems, requests for sick leave, vacation time, overtime and assignments for duty
Demonstrate high standards of courtesy, performance, documentation, diplomacy and respect for confidentiality
Qualification
Required
Must have working-level knowledge of the English language, including reading, writing, and speaking English
Requires 24 months of patient accounting, medical billing, general medical office or medical claims processing experience
In addition, six months of credit, insurance, governmental program experience and/or direct customer service experience is required
Nevada Medicaid Hospital Presumptive Eligibility (HPE) Certification required within 12 months of hire
Must possess, or be able to obtain within 90 days, the computer skills necessary to complete online learning requirements for job-specific competencies, access online forms and policies, complete online benefits enrollment, etc
Requires the ability to type 35 to 45 words per minute
Preferred
Associate degree or bachelor's degree preferred
Bilingual (Spanish) preferred
Experience with MS Windows NT or MS Windows 2000, MS Office, SMS Invision, Internet and SMS IMS Document Imaging preferred
Notary Public Certification preferred
